Target (NYSE:TGT - Get Free Report) has been given a $107.00 price objective by stock analysts at Truist Financial in a research note issued to investors on Wednesday, Marketbeat Ratings reports. The brokerage presently has a "hold" rating on the retailer's stock. Truist Financial's price target points to a potential upside of 2.41% from the company's previous close.

Several other research analysts also recently commented on TGT. Wall Street Zen downgraded Target from a "hold" rating to a "sell" rating in a research note on Saturday. Barclays reissued an "underweight" rating and issued a $91.00 price objective on shares of Target in a research note on Monday, July 21st. Robert W. Baird set a $100.00 price objective on Target in a research note on Thursday, May 22nd. Royal Bank Of Canada reduced their price objective on Target from $112.00 to $103.00 and set an "outperform" rating for the company in a research note on Thursday, May 22nd. Finally, Wells Fargo & Company reduced their price objective on Target from $135.00 to $115.00 and set an "overweight" rating for the company in a research note on Thursday, May 22nd. Three anal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, twenty-three have given a hold rating and ten have given a buy rating to the st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, the company presently has a consensus rating of "Hold" and an average price target of $115.81.

Target Stock Performance

Target stock traded down $0.64 during mid-day trading on Wednesday, hitting $104.48. The company had a trading volume of 2,809,485 shares, compared to its average volume of 6,888,315. The company has a current ratio of 0.94, a quick ratio of 0.25 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.96. Target has a 12-month low of $87.35 and a 12-month high of $167.40. The company's fifty day moving average is $101.22 and its 200-day moving average is $105.64. The company has a market capitalization of $47.47 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 11.48, a P/E/G ratio of 2.99 and a beta of 1.22.

Target (NYSE:TGT -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Wednesday, May 21st. The retailer reported $1.30 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$1.65 by ($0.35). Target had a net margin of 3.95% and a return on equity of 25.59%. The business had revenue of $24.20 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$24.54 billion.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$2.03 EPS. The company's quarterly revenue was down 2.8%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ts predict that Target will post 8.69 EPS for the current year.

Insider Buying and Selling

In other Target news, insider Brian C. Cornell sold 45,000 shares of Target st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, May 28th. The stock was sold at an average price of $96.18, for a total transaction of $4,328,100.00. Following the transaction, the insider owned 246,453 shares of the company's stock, valued at $23,703,849.54. The trade was a 15.44%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available at this hyperlink. 0.16%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

Target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Target Corporation operates as a general merchandise retailer in the United States. The company offers apparel for women, men, boys, girls, toddlers, and infants and newborns, as well as jewelry, accessories, and shoes; and beauty and personal care, baby gear, cleaning, paper products, and pet supplies.
